Kyushu International Sightseeing Square Opens in Fukuoka

On Jul. 27 (Wed.), Kyushu International Sightseeing Square (KISS) opened in Hakata-ku, Fukuoka. Aimed at inbound tourists, the complex includes stores, restaurants and a stage. The shopping area’s kimono and ninja outfit-clad staff sell 3,000 products, mainly from Kyushu and Okinawa, including crafts, food, miscellaneous goods, cosmetics, souvenirs and more. A food court offers Japanese and western cuisine made with Kyushu ingredients. There will occasionally be performances showing off Kyushu’s culture on the stage. KISS hopes to attract 300,000 visitors in its first year, and their sales target is ¥3 billion. Click here for the official English website. Address: 5-18-43 Nishitsukiguma, Hakata-ku. Hours: 10:00~20:00. Source: Net IB News, 7/27
